? If you've found out the nuances of your favorite device, and your technique is solid, then you likely have the needed accuracy. You 'd be even extra precise with a shorter pole. With the pointer of the fishing pole even more from your hand, that tip is more difficult to manage.
The little activities we make with our pole hand the minor spins and pushes of the wrist are amplified via the size of the pole. And when the energy of those activities reaches the idea, the short, crisp activity we made with our casting hand lead to a much larger activity at the idea.
Stand in casting setting, and relocate the rod-hand simply one foot with its spreading V. Now seek out and watch the pole pointer. It relocates a lot greater than twelve inches. Doesn't it? And the longer the pole, the better is that range. So our pole hand movements are magnified with longer rods. there's even more rod that has to quit moving.
